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Rockingham County
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Rockingham County?
Actualmente hay 64 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Rockingham County, NC con precios que van desde $700 hasta $1,500. También hay 23 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Rockingham County que van desde $375 hasta $2,700.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Rockingham County?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Rockingham County oscilan entre $375 hasta $2,700 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,360.
